Frontline aired a great report of the deal-making, arm-twisting, and self-dealing that occurred among the Treasury, Fed, and major banks during last fall's crisis, with a focus on the Bank of America/Merrill Lynch shotgun marriage.
The report should be required viewing for Money & Banking classes going forward.
